Open: Grandfield Housing Authority Public Housing

The Grandfield Housing Authority (GHA) is currently accepting Public Housing waiting list pre-applications for families and senior/disabled households.The GHA offers one Public Housing community with 40 units for families and senior/disabled households, ranging in size from 1 to 3 bedrooms.To apply, visit the GHA office to pick up a pre-application, located at 130 E 1st St., Grandfield, OK 73546, from 8:00 am until 4:00 pm CT, Monday-Friday.Once the pre-applicaiton has been completed, it must be hand delivered to the address listed above, from 8:00 am until 4:00 pm, Monday-Friday. It is best to call the office at (580) 479-5256 before visiting the GHA.Be sure to include these documents with the pre-application: Social Security Cards and birth certificates for all household members, photo IDs for all adult household members, and proof of all income.The GHA does not have a preference.Qualified applicants will be placed on the waiting list by the date and time the pre-application is received.The current wait time for Public Housing is approximately 12-18 months.For more information, call the GHA office at (580) 479-5256 from 8:00 am until 4:00 pm, Monday-Friday.

Reasonable Accommodation

Applicants who need help completing the application due to disability can make a reasonable accommodation request to the housing authority via (580)479-5256.

About Grandfield Housing Authority

130 1st Street, Grandfield, OK (580) 479-5256

Grandfield Housing Authority provides affordable housing for up to 40 low and moderate income households through its Public Housing program..

Housing Authority Jurisdiction

Low-income housing managed by Grandfield Housing Authority is located in Grandfield, OK.

Households with a Section 8 Housing Choice Voucher managed by this housing authority must rent within its jurisdiction.
